About the event

The inspiring story of British farmers standing up against the industrial food system and transforming the way they produce food - to heal the soil, benefit our health, and provide for local communities. This is one of two evening events at Village Farm. 

The evening will consist of a film screening, and a Q&A with prominent local regenerative farmers over refreshments, with the option to walk around Lisa's Village Farm community veg garden. This is a rustic event where we'll be hosted in one of our barns and seated on straw bales. Feel free to bring a rug or a chair for your extra comfort.  Topics may include regenerative farming, farming for wildlife, farming in the future, and sustainable farming. This is a chance to talk to a real farmer, and hear about how he manages a non-organic farm with wildlife in mind.
